Is Chi-Chi's® Restaurant Style Medium Salsa 16 oz. Bottle Alpha-Gal?

Yes! We believe this product is alpha-gal free as there are no alpha-gal ingredients listed on the label.

Description

Medium salsa offers a balanced, tangy flavor with moderate heat and a bright finish; texture is slightly chunky with finely diced pieces and a saucy base. Shoppers commonly use it for dipping tortilla chips, topping tacos and burritos, stirring into rice or eggs, and adding flavor to snacks or meals.

Ingredients

TOMATOES IN TOMATO JUICE (CONTAINS CITRIC ACID [TO ACIDIFY], CALCIUM CHLORIDE [FIRMING]), JALAPENO PEPPERS, WATER, ONIONS, TOMATO PASTE, CONTAIN 2% OR LESS OF SALT, CITRIC ACID (TO ACIDIFY), SPICES, DEHYDRATED GARLIC, ONION POWDER, SODIUM BENZOATE (PRESERVATIVE), WHITE VINEGAR.

What is a Alpha-Gal diet?

An Alpha-Gal diet eliminates mammalian meat and products containing mammalian-derived ingredients to prevent allergic reactions in people with alpha-gal syndrome. This includes beef, pork, lamb, dairy products, gelatin, and certain medications derived from mammals. The condition involves a specific sugar molecule found in most mammals, often triggered after a tick bite. People may experience delayed allergic reactions 3-6 hours after consuming trigger foods. The diet focuses on safe alternatives like poultry, fish, and plant-based proteins. When followed carefully, often with guidance from an allergist or dietitian, it can prevent serious reactions while maintaining adequate nutrition.
